What is Verification?
Verification is a process to confirm that information provided on the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) is accurate.
Note: Not all files are selected for verification. If your file is selected for verification you will be notified by the School of Medicine and asked to provide specific documentation, such as federal tax transcripts.
Reasons A File May Be Selected For Verification:
-
The Department of Education randomly selects a certain number of student files
-
The school selects the files of students who report either zero or unusually low income, and any time there is discrepant data that must be resolved
-
You select yourself when you apply for institutional need-based aid with the OUWB School of Medicine
-
You are an independent student when applying for federal aid. Your parents’ income and assets have no bearing on your eligibility to borrow Federal Direct Loans or Graduate PLUS loans.
-
When you enter parent income and asset information on your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), the OUWB School of Medicine uses the information to determine whether or not you are eligible for need-based institutional awards. You will be asked to provide documentation such as federal tax forms, to verify your income and assets, and your parents’ income and assets.
-
If your parents are divorced, you must provide information from the last parent you resided with for at least six months, or who provided more than 50% of your financial support. If this parent is remarried, you must also provide their spouse’s information.
-
If both of your parents are deceased, please provide copies of their death certificates to exempt yourself from this requirement.
-
If you decide that you do not want to provide the documentation and no longer wish for your eligibility for this type of award to be determined, you may submit a Revision Form available on the Financial Services website to request that we cancel the review of your file.
